What Does a Mental Health Psychologist Do? Mental Health Psychologists help individuals manage and overcome emotional, cognitive, and behavioural challenges. They work with people of all ages, using therapeutic techniques to improve mental well-being. By working as a SEN Teaching Assistant, you will gain direct experience in understanding how mental health affects learning and behaviour, making this an ideal stepping stone towards a psychology-based career. Before You Apply

Do not include the following in your job application, CV, or cover letter:

  • Bank details.
  • National Insurance number.
  • Date of birth.

You should not be asked for payment or irrelevant information. If you have concerns about a job advert or employer, seek guidance on how to proceed.
